Q3 PLANNING NOTE — Insurance Renewal
To: Heads of Department, Velspar Logistics

Property and fleet cover renews in October. Broker signals a 12% premium rise; higher deductibles under negotiation. Submit updated asset registers and claims summaries by end of August. Late submissions risk gaps in cover. No exceptions. Implications for next year's plan are noted below.

board note of tadup-tajog: Headcount on the Oliiel team goes from 31 to 88 by the end of February. Gross margin on Oliiel came in at 62 percent against a plan of 29 percent.

## Quillfind Environments: Nightly Reindex

Quillfind runs a full search reindex every night in each environment. Plugin authors should assume their custom analyzers will be reloaded during this window, so avoid caching analyzer state across runs. Staging reindexes two hours before production, which makes it the right place to validate new tokenizer plugins. Timeouts and batch sizes differ per environment, so test against staging values first. The current staging configuration is as follows.

deployment values, kajep-kageg:
[praix]
host = praix.paliqcorp.corp
user = praix_svc
database = praix_prod

Veltrix Software will launch a new subscription tier, "Atlas Plus," in the next quarter. The tier sits between Standard and Enterprise, bundling advanced reporting and priority support at a projected 40% margin. Early pilots with two regional accounts in Harwick showed upgrade intent above forecast. Billing changes are minor; revenue recognition follows existing schedules. Churn risk on the Standard tier is modeled at under two points. Before approving rollout, note the confidential strategic context appended below:

confidential, fahag-yahap: Project Raleth slips by six weeks because of the tooling delay.

Runbook fragment — FeedProbe, our podcast feed validator. Before approving a deploy, confirm the validator image was built from a tagged commit, not a branch head; Marnie's earlier incident came from an untagged build silently skipping the enclosure-size checks. Run the smoke suite against the Larkspur staging feeds, verify all twelve fixture feeds pass, and check that malformed-XML cases still return structured errors rather than panics. Document any deviation in the review thread. The build under review is identified by the token below.

build token for tawip-yageg: htk9_92ac43d42